Background

Born in Stony Point, New York, on February 8, 1970, the journey of this talented actress began as the youngest of three siblings.
Stephanie Courtney graduated from Binghamton University in 1992, earning a Bachelor of Arts degree in English. During her college years, she developed her acting skills through various theater productions. After graduation, she moved to New York City, where she worked as a secretary while studying acting at the Neighborhood Playhouse.
In the late 1990s, seeking to advance her career in acting and comedy, Courtney relocated to Los Angeles. She further honed her craft by joining the Groundlings improv group in 2004, a significant step in her pursuit of recognition in the entertainment industry.
Stephanie's big break came in 2008 when she was officially cast as Flo in Progressive Insurance commercials. This role not only showcased her comedic talents but also marked a turning point in her career, leading to widespread acclaim.

Is Stephanie Courtney Married?
Yes, Stephanie Courtney is married. She tied the knot with fellow actor Scott Kolanach in 2008 after several years of dating.
The couple enjoys a low-key lifestyle, keeping their personal life private while supporting each other's careers. Kolanach works as a stage manager, contributing to various productions, and they focus on their professional endeavors rather than starting a family.
